On Eisenhower Avenue in Alexandria, centered smack dab between the blue line Van Dorn metro stop and Whole Foods Market at the gateway to Old Town Alexandria lies the popular townhouse community Townes at Cameron Parke.  This neighborhood of 230 townhouses offers stylish living with easy access to area transportation and attractions.

Public Transportation at your Doorstep

Townes at Cameron Parke is close to Old Town AlexandriaWhether you work in Old Town Alexandria, Washington D.C., elsewhere in Northern Virginia, or even Maryland, living at the Townes at Cameron Parke makes your commute easy.  The DART bus stops on Eisenhower Avenue right in front of the neighborhood.  Old Town is a quick and easy 2 mile drive east.  The on-ramp for the Capital Beltway, Route 495 to Tysons Corner and 95 to the Wilson Bridge and Maryland is only a mile away.  Van Dorn metro station is just two miles west down Eisenhower.

DISTANCE TO PENTAGON:  5 MILES

DISTANCE TO FORT BELVOIR:  < 10 MILES

Maybe you work at the U.S. Patent and Trademark Office.  You won't have to worry about your commute at all if you purchase a home at the Townes at Cameron Parke.  Your office will be about a mile and a half down the road, an easy walk or bike ride on the nearby bikepath.  Similarly, 1.5 miles in the other direction will lead you to the currently under redevelopment Victory Center, a 1.25 million square foot office building expected to house many military personnel being relocated by BRAC.

The townhomes at Townes at Cameron Parke offer one or two car garages and range in size from 1,566 square feet to 2,432 square feet of spacious living space.  During the last 6 months from August 2007 through mid-February 2008, there have been 11 sales at an average net sales price of $507,226, approximately 96.9% of the seller asking price.  The neighborhood also features a small clubhouse and pool in the center near the main entrance, and a tot lot playground in the back end of the community.

What else is nearby?

  • Lake Cook -- an urban fishing locationHow about fishing?  Fishing?  Yes, you read right.  Lake Cook, an urban fishing location is just adjacent to the Townes at Cameron Station and a popular site for trout and channel catfish. 


  • Water slides, wave pool, miniature golf, and batting cages, woohoo!  Fun Summer activities for kids and adults await at Cameron Run Regional Park.  On every Summer afternoon, you'll find hundreds of soaked & smiling faces young and old riding the waves and sashaying down the water slide at this popular park.

  • Try some miniature golf at Cameron Run Regional ParkBike paths, running, ball fields.  For about 4.5 miles from the West End of Alexandria to Old Town, Eisenhower Avenue provides a very flat, picturesque venue for running, bicycling, or even taking a spin on rollerblades.

Hi, this is good info but does the location a disservice considering the negatives of the location.  We checked out the neighborhood several times and were surprised to be overwhelmed by the noise from commuter and metro trains passing by directly behind the property.  No mention of the severity of this noise anywhere.  Readers and prospective buyers should be advised.
